British conductor, organist, and pianist Wayne Marshall returns to lead the Estonian National Symphony Orchestra following his sold-out performances in December 2019. Marshall is a masterful and versatile musician, equally at home on the podium or as a soloist at the piano or organ.

From 2014 to 2020, Marshall served as Chief Conductor of the WDR Funkhausorchester, and from 2007 to 2013, he was the Principal Guest Conductor of the Orchestra Sinfonica di Milano Giuseppe Verdi. He is a celebrated interpreter of Gershwin, Bernstein, and other 20th-century American composers. His credits include conducting Bernstein's "Candide" (Berlin State Opera, Opéra de Lyon), "Mass" (Orchestre de Paris), and "White House Cantata" (Netherlands Radio Philharmonic Orchestra).

Marshall’s wide-ranging repertoire also includes John Harbison’s "The Great Gatsby" (Semperoper), Jake Heggie’s "Dead Man Walking" (Opéra de Montréal), and numerous productions of George Gershwin’s "Porgy and Bess", including at the Opéra-Comique, Washington National Opera, Dallas Opera, and Vienna State Opera.
